Why Energy-Efficient Windows Matter

Windows are often the weakest link in a home's insulation. Improperly sealed or damaged windows can lead to drafts, wetness seepage, and ultimately higher energy costs. According to research studies, up to 30% of a home's heating and cooling energy can be lost through windows. This loss not just impacts energy usage but likewise impacts indoor comfort.

The benefits of energy-efficient windows consist of:

  • Reduced Energy Costs: Properly insulated windows can reduce heating & cooling expenditures.
  • Boosted Comfort: Well-maintained windows keep indoor temperatures more stable.
  • Increased Home Value: Energy-efficient upgrades can increase a home's market price.
  • Ecological Impact: Lower energy usage adds to a decrease in greenhouse gas emissions.

Kinds Of Window Repairs

Repairing windows can take numerous kinds, depending upon the issues at hand. Common types of window repairs that boost energy performance include:

  1. Weatherstripping: Installing or replacing weatherstripping assists seal spaces around the window, avoiding air leak.
  2. Caulking: Applying caulk around window frames can fill out cracks and spaces that contribute to energy loss.
  3. Glass Repair or Replacement: Broken or cloudy glass reduces insulation. Choices consist of fixing the glass or replacing it with double or triple-pane units.
  4. Frame Repair: Wooden frames may rot or weaken with time. Fixing or changing the frame can improve the total performance of the window.
  5. Insulating Window Treatments: Adding insulating window treatments, such as cellular tones, can further improve the energy performance of existing windows.

Expense of Window Repairs

The expense of window repairs can vary extensively depending on the kind of repair needed and the products utilized. Below is a general introduction of possible costs associated with common window repair types:

Repair TypeAverage Cost Range (per window)
Weatherstripping₤ 10 - ₤ 30
Caulking₤ 5 - ₤ 15
Glass Repair₤ 50 - ₤ 200
Glass Replacement₤ 200 - ₤ 500
Frame Repair₤ 50 - ₤ 150
Insulating Treatments₤ 30 - ₤ 100

Often Asked Questions (FAQ)

1. How do I know if my windows need repairs?

Signs your windows might need repair include drafts, condensation in between panes, noticeable cracks or gaps, and problem opening or closing them.

2. Can I perform window repairs myself?

For minor repairs like caulking and weatherstripping, house owners can often do it themselves. Nevertheless, for considerable issues like glass replacement or frame repair, it might be a good idea to hire a professional.

3. How typically should I inspect my windows for energy efficiency?

It's a good idea to examine your windows each year, specifically before heating or cooling seasons, to ensure they stay energy effective.

4. What are the benefits of double or triple-pane windows?

Double and triple-pane windows provide better insulation than single-pane alternatives, reducing energy loss and improving convenience in severe temperatures.

5. Will energy-efficient window repair receive tax credits?

Homeowners may get approved for tax credits or refunds for energy-efficient upgrades, including window repairs. It is vital to check local or federal programs for eligibility.
